This is a file centered around healthy eating, body confidence, and regular exercise. It does not prescribe a form for these habits, leaving that to the listener. Instead the topic is the formation of habits generally - that very much is outside of our control and we should best make gradual changes instead. Crash diets, or harsh exercise programs, are more likely to be given up because they involve a reduction in pleasurable experiences (relaxation, comfort food) and a high spike in unpleasant experiences (the aforementioned terrible dieting or exercise). The topic of our habits and how they form, is laid out alongside body-positive messages and perspective about your slow improvement and integration of positive habits.

This isn't some strict you-must-do method, like the usual magic bullet weight loss and exercise marketing. Instead this piece elaborates that forming a habit is like changing the course of a river, not flipping a switch on the train tracks. It is free, so give it a try.
